MA 02649 <br /> DECISION <br /> RE: Petition of Angelo & Thalia Toyias for a Special Permit Case <br /> #SP-87-03-028 <br /> A Petition was filed by Angelo & Thalia Toyias of Mashpee, Mass- <br /> achusetts for a Special Permit for permission to construct a timber <br /> stairway, pier, gangway and float in a R-3M Zoning District on property <br /> located on 44 Wheelhouse Drive (lot 156) , Mashpee, Massachusetts. <br /> Notice was duly given to abutters in accordance with Massachusetts <br /> General Laws Chapter 40A. Notice was given by publication in the - <br /> Falmouth Enterprise, a newspaper of general circulation in the Town <br /> of Mashpee on February 25 & March 4, 1987, a copy of which is attached <br /> hereto and made a part hereof. <br /> A public hearing was held on the petition at the Mashpee Town <br /> Hall on Wednesday, March 11, 1987 at 7:30 p.m. at which time the follow- <br /> ing members of the Board of Appeals were present and acting throughout: <br /> William Hanrahan, Cheryl Hawver and Thomas Sexton. <br /> The Board was informed the pier wil extend a distance of sixteen <br /> feet from the mean low water mark. Information was received that a <br /> small boat will be moored at. the dock and will be utilized for recrea- <br /> tional use only. No objections were voiced by abutters present. <br /> Upon motion duly made and seconded the Board of Appeals voted <br /> unanimously on March 11, 1987 to grant the Special Permit as requested <br /> with the stipulation this applicant comply with all "Orders of Conditions" <br /> setforth by the Mashpee Conservation Commission. <br />
